In order to participate in Berklee Student Employment, a student must fulfill the following requirements :
- Current student at Berklee College of Music or Boston Conservatory at Berklee.
- Enrolled at least half-time in a degree, diploma, or certificate-seeking undergraduate or graduate program. Summer is the only semester in which a student can maintain employment without being enrolled. In this case, the student must be pre-registered for the upcoming fall semester. This exception does not apply to fall or spring semesters.
- Have a valid United States Social Security Number (SSN).
- Remain in "valid" Visa status as applicable.
- A minimum 2.0 cumulative GPA. Students in their first semester can work, even though they do not have an official GPA until the completion of their first semester.
- Federal Work Study student may apply.
- In good disciplinary standing.
- Must be located in the U.S.

The music notation specialist assistant provides notation support to the Music Notation Specialist and to the Course Developers Team at Berklee POPP, In the production of online courses for Berklee Online.
The student is expected to be detail-oriented, prompt, and comfortable with various software, in addition to having strong communication skills and an eagerness to learn.
